How Our Team Performs Carpet Pad Water Extraction
At our company, we understand that a proper water extraction process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ring a successful restoration. Our technician’s follow a detailed process to ensure every step is completed efficiently and effectively.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technician will conduct a thorough inspection of your home to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to assess the severity of the damage and find out the best course of action. This step is crucial in determining the best strategy for extraction.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using advanced equipment, our technicians will extract as much water as possible from the carpet pad and underlying structures. We’ll use a combination of wet vacuums, pumps, and other specialized equipment to remove the water and reduce the risk of further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
With the water removed, our technician will focus on drying and dehumidifying the affected area. We’ll use specialized equipment to monitor the moisture levels and ensure the area is completely dry before proceeding. This step is critical in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, our technician will th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old, mildew, and bacteria.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ure the area is completely free of contaminants.
Step 5: Monitoring and Follow-up
Finally, our technician will conduct a thorough inspection of the affected area to ensure everything is in order. Warning Signs You Need Carpet Pad Water Extraction
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common warning signs that show you need carpet pad water extraction: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s likely due to water-soaked carpet pad. Don’t ignore this warning sign!
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your carpet, walls, or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age. Don’t delay!
Unusual Wear and Tear
Water damage can cause your carpet to become uneven, wrinkled, or discolored. If you notice unusual wear and tear on your carpet, it may be a sign of underlying water damage. Investigate further!
Water Damage in Unseen Areas
Water damage can occur in unseen areas, such as beneath the carpet pad, behind walls, or under flooring. If you suspect water damage in an unseen area, it’s crucial to act quickly to prevent further damage. Don’t delay!
Visible Mold or Mildew
Mold and mildew growth can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any visible mold or mildew on your walls, ceilings, or carpet, it’s essential to take action immediately. Don’t risk your health!
Carpet Pad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, isolated water stain | Yes | No | Simple to clean and dry on your own. |
| Large, complex water damage |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Visible m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Presents a health risk and needs professional remediation. |
| Unseen water damage |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air. |
| Insurance claim or dispute | No | Yes | Needs professional documentation and negotiation to ensure fair compensation. |
